What is Particulate Contamination?

Particulate contamination refers to the presence of foreign particles or substances in a product or system that can negatively impact its performance, quality, or safety. These particles can come from various sources, including dust, dirt, metals, fibers, microorganisms, and other contaminants. In industries like pharmaceuticals and medical devices, particulate contamination can be particularly problematic, as it can lead to product recalls, compromised patient safety, and regulatory issues.

How particulate contamination testing is Conducted

There are several methods for conducting particulate contamination tests, depending on the type of product or system being tested. One common method is to use microscopy to visually inspect samples for the presence of particulate contaminants. This can help identify the size, shape, and composition of the particles present, as well as determine their potential impact on the product or system.

Another method for particulate contamination testing is to use particle counters, which are instruments designed to detect and quantify the levels of particulate contamination in a sample. These devices can provide valuable data on the concentration of particles present, as well as their size distribution and other characteristics. By using particle counters, manufacturers can accurately assess the levels of contamination in their products or systems and take appropriate actions to address any issues.
